How to extract the values from two consecutive rows

Hi,

 

I have measurements of an equipment that produces tablets. The operator logs the value that the machine shows every 15 minutes. This value shows how many tablets were produced from the last reset.

I would like to see how many tablets were produced between two consecutive measurements.

  • Hi Nandor. One way to do it would be to add an Index column to your dataset. While you're in the query editor, you can go to Add Column > Add Index Column. Then you can go to the Data view and Add New Column where you subtract the row where the index is one less the current row. Something like:

     

    Column = TableName[Tablets] - LOOKUPVALUE(TableName[Tablets], TableName[Index], TableName[Index]-1)

     

    Just be sure your data is sorted properly before adding the Index column!
